    Volume 31, Issue 3, Pages 385 - 407 (June 2008)


TSUNAMI COMPUTATION ALONG NORTH SUMATRA AND PENANG ISLAND DUE TO A TIME DEPENDENT SOURCE ASSOCIATED WITH THE INDONESIAN TSUNAMI 2004 USING A POLAR COORDINATE SHALLOW WATER MODEL

Md. Fazlul Karim (Malaysia), G. D. Roy (Bangladesh), Ahmad Izani M. Ismail (Malaysia) and Mohammed Ashaque Meah (Malaysia)

Received January 21, 2008
